0924《單片機(jī)原理與接口技術(shù)》_第1頁
0924《單片機(jī)原理與接口技術(shù)》_第2頁
0924《單片機(jī)原理與接口技術(shù)》_第3頁
0924《單片機(jī)原理與接口技術(shù)》_第4頁
0924《單片機(jī)原理與接口技術(shù)》_第5頁
已閱讀5頁,還剩3頁未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

[0924]《單片機(jī)原理與接口技術(shù)》摘要:

單片機(jī)作為一種集成了CPU、存儲器和輸入輸出接口的微型計(jì)算機(jī),在工業(yè)控制、智能家居、嵌入式系統(tǒng)等領(lǐng)域得到了廣泛應(yīng)用。本文針對單片機(jī)原理與接口技術(shù),分析了其基本原理、工作流程以及在實(shí)際應(yīng)用中遇到的問題,探討了影響單片機(jī)性能的關(guān)鍵因素,并提出了相應(yīng)的實(shí)踐對策。通過深入研究單片機(jī)原理與接口技術(shù),旨在提高單片機(jī)應(yīng)用水平,為相關(guān)領(lǐng)域的發(fā)展提供理論支持。

關(guān)鍵詞:單片機(jī);原理;接口技術(shù);實(shí)踐對策

一、引言

隨著科技的飛速發(fā)展,單片機(jī)作為一種功能強(qiáng)大、體積小巧的微型計(jì)算機(jī),已經(jīng)在各個(gè)領(lǐng)域發(fā)揮著越來越重要的作用。從工業(yè)控制到智能家居,從嵌入式系統(tǒng)到物聯(lián)網(wǎng),單片機(jī)都扮演著不可或缺的角色。那么,什么是單片機(jī)?它的工作原理是怎樣的?在實(shí)際應(yīng)用中又會(huì)遇到哪些問題呢?接下來,我們就來聊一聊單片機(jī)原理與接口技術(shù)。

首先,得先弄明白什么是單片機(jī)。簡單來說,單片機(jī)就是一塊集成了中央處理器(CPU)、存儲器(RAM和ROM)以及輸入輸出接口(I/O)的芯片。它就像是一個(gè)小型的電腦,可以執(zhí)行各種復(fù)雜的計(jì)算和操作。由于單片機(jī)體積小、功耗低、成本低,因此在很多場合都能看到它的身影。

在實(shí)際應(yīng)用中,單片機(jī)面臨著許多挑戰(zhàn)。比如,如何保證單片機(jī)的穩(wěn)定性和可靠性?如何提高單片機(jī)的處理速度和性能?如何降低單片機(jī)的功耗和成本?這些都是我們在設(shè)計(jì)和使用單片機(jī)時(shí)需要考慮的問題。

首先,穩(wěn)定性和可靠性是單片機(jī)應(yīng)用的基礎(chǔ)。為了保證單片機(jī)的穩(wěn)定運(yùn)行,我們需要從硬件和軟件兩個(gè)方面入手。在硬件方面,要選擇質(zhì)量可靠的芯片和元器件,同時(shí)注意電路的布局和布線,避免電磁干擾和信號衰減。在軟件方面,要編寫嚴(yán)謹(jǐn)?shù)某绦虼a,避免出現(xiàn)邏輯錯(cuò)誤和資源沖突。

其次,提高單片機(jī)的處理速度和性能是提升其應(yīng)用價(jià)值的關(guān)鍵。這需要我們從以下幾個(gè)方面入手:一是優(yōu)化程序算法,提高代碼執(zhí)行效率;二是合理配置硬件資源,比如增加緩存、使用高速存儲器等;三是采用多任務(wù)處理技術(shù),實(shí)現(xiàn)并行計(jì)算。

再者,降低單片機(jī)的功耗和成本是推動(dòng)其廣泛應(yīng)用的重要條件。在功耗方面,可以通過以下幾種方式來降低:一是選擇低功耗的芯片和元器件;二是優(yōu)化電路設(shè)計(jì),減少不必要的功耗;三是采用節(jié)能技術(shù),比如在空閑時(shí)關(guān)閉部分模塊。在成本方面,可以通過以下幾種方式來降低:一是選擇性價(jià)比高的元器件;二是采用模塊化設(shè)計(jì),減少開發(fā)周期和成本;三是批量采購,降低采購成本。

二、問題學(xué)理分析

在深入了解了單片機(jī)的基本概念和它在各個(gè)領(lǐng)域的應(yīng)用之后,我們開始分析單片機(jī)在實(shí)際應(yīng)用中遇到的問題,以及這些問題背后的學(xué)理原因。

1.穩(wěn)定性與可靠性的挑戰(zhàn)

單片機(jī)在工業(yè)控制等領(lǐng)域應(yīng)用廣泛,對穩(wěn)定性和可靠性的要求極高。然而,由于外部環(huán)境的變化、電路的復(fù)雜性以及軟件設(shè)計(jì)的缺陷,單片機(jī)可能會(huì)出現(xiàn)運(yùn)行不穩(wěn)定、故障率高等問題。從學(xué)理上分析,這些問題主要源于以下幾個(gè)方面:

-硬件設(shè)計(jì):電路設(shè)計(jì)不合理,元器件選擇不當(dāng),可能導(dǎo)致電磁干擾、信號衰減等問題。

-軟件編程:程序設(shè)計(jì)復(fù)雜,邏輯錯(cuò)誤或資源沖突,可能導(dǎo)致系統(tǒng)崩潰或運(yùn)行緩慢。

-環(huán)境因素:高溫、濕度、振動(dòng)等環(huán)境因素,可能對單片機(jī)的穩(wěn)定運(yùn)行造成影響。

2.性能提升的瓶頸

單片機(jī)的性能直接影響到其在各個(gè)領(lǐng)域的應(yīng)用效果。在實(shí)際應(yīng)用中,我們常常會(huì)遇到以下瓶頸:

-處理速度:隨著應(yīng)用需求的提高,單片機(jī)的處理速度成為制約其性能的關(guān)鍵因素。

-存儲空間:有限的存儲空間可能無法滿足復(fù)雜程序和大量數(shù)據(jù)的需求。

-外設(shè)支持:單片機(jī)的外設(shè)接口能力不足,可能限制其在某些領(lǐng)域的應(yīng)用。

3.功耗與成本的平衡

在追求高性能的同時(shí),功耗和成本也是不可忽視的問題。以下是影響單片機(jī)功耗和成本的因素:

-功耗:低功耗設(shè)計(jì)是提高單片機(jī)應(yīng)用效率的重要手段。然而,在追求低功耗的同時(shí),可能會(huì)犧牲性能和功能。

-成本:單片機(jī)的成本受制于元器件價(jià)格、生產(chǎn)工藝和批量采購等因素。如何在保證性能的前提下降低成本,是一個(gè)需要綜合考慮的問題。

4.技術(shù)更新與人才培養(yǎng)

隨著科技的不斷進(jìn)步,單片機(jī)技術(shù)也在不斷發(fā)展。然而,技術(shù)更新速度加快,人才培養(yǎng)卻跟不上步伐,導(dǎo)致以下問題:

-技術(shù)更新:新技術(shù)的出現(xiàn)可能使得現(xiàn)有單片機(jī)應(yīng)用面臨淘汰的風(fēng)險(xiǎn)。

-人才培養(yǎng):缺乏具有單片機(jī)專業(yè)知識和實(shí)踐經(jīng)驗(yàn)的工程師,影響單片機(jī)技術(shù)的推廣和應(yīng)用。

三、現(xiàn)實(shí)阻礙

在單片機(jī)的實(shí)際應(yīng)用過程中,我們遇到了不少現(xiàn)實(shí)中的阻礙,這些阻礙不僅影響了單片機(jī)的性能,也給我們的工作帶來了不少挑戰(zhàn)。

1.硬件方面的限制

首先,硬件的限制是影響單片機(jī)性能的一大因素。比如,市場上可供選擇的單片機(jī)種類繁多,但每種單片機(jī)的性能、功耗、接口等方面都有其限制。有時(shí)候,一個(gè)設(shè)計(jì)得再好的單片機(jī),也因?yàn)橛布旧淼南拗贫鵁o法滿足特定的應(yīng)用需求。比如,某些應(yīng)用需要高處理速度的單片機(jī),但市場上可能只有一些性能較低的產(chǎn)品可供選擇。

2.軟件編程的復(fù)雜性

軟件編程是單片機(jī)應(yīng)用的核心,但它的復(fù)雜性也是一個(gè)不小的阻礙。編程語言的選擇、程序的優(yōu)化、算法的效率等,都是我們需要考慮的問題。而且,隨著應(yīng)用場景的復(fù)雜化,編寫一個(gè)穩(wěn)定、高效、可維護(hù)的軟件程序變得越來越困難。

3.環(huán)境因素的干擾

在實(shí)際應(yīng)用中,單片機(jī)往往需要工作在各種復(fù)雜的環(huán)境中,如高溫、濕度、振動(dòng)等。這些環(huán)境因素可能會(huì)對單片機(jī)的穩(wěn)定性產(chǎn)生嚴(yán)重影響。比如,一個(gè)設(shè)計(jì)精良的單片機(jī)可能在高溫環(huán)境下運(yùn)行不穩(wěn)定,或者因?yàn)闈穸忍蠖鴮?dǎo)致電路板受潮。

4.技術(shù)更新?lián)Q代的速度

技術(shù)更新?lián)Q代的速度非常快,新的技術(shù)和產(chǎn)品層出不窮。這對于單片機(jī)的應(yīng)用來說,是一個(gè)巨大的挑戰(zhàn)。一方面,我們需要不斷學(xué)習(xí)新的技術(shù),以適應(yīng)不斷變化的市場需求;另一方面,我們也需要考慮到舊技術(shù)的淘汰問題,如何在新舊技術(shù)之間找到平衡,是一個(gè)需要深思的問題。

5.人才培養(yǎng)的滯后

人才是技術(shù)發(fā)展的關(guān)鍵,但單片機(jī)領(lǐng)域的人才培養(yǎng)卻相對滯后。這主要體現(xiàn)在兩個(gè)方面:一是單片機(jī)專業(yè)人才的缺乏,二是現(xiàn)有工程師對新技術(shù)掌握不足。這導(dǎo)致了單片機(jī)技術(shù)的推廣和應(yīng)用受到了限制。

6.成本控制的問題

成本是商業(yè)成功的重要因素,但在單片機(jī)應(yīng)用中,成本控制也是一個(gè)難點(diǎn)。如何在保證性能和品質(zhì)的前提下,降低成本,是一個(gè)需要綜合考慮的問題。同時(shí),成本的降低也可能影響到單片機(jī)的質(zhì)量和穩(wěn)定性。

四、實(shí)踐對策

面對單片機(jī)應(yīng)用中的種種現(xiàn)實(shí)阻礙,我們需要采取一系列實(shí)踐對策來克服這些問題,確保單片機(jī)能夠更好地服務(wù)于各個(gè)領(lǐng)域。

1.硬件選型與優(yōu)化

在硬件選擇上,要根據(jù)具體的應(yīng)用需求來挑選合適的單片機(jī)。比如,對于需要高處理速度的應(yīng)用,可以選擇高性能的單片機(jī);對于對功耗要求較高的應(yīng)用,可以選擇低功耗的單片機(jī)。同時(shí),通過優(yōu)化電路設(shè)計(jì),減少電磁干擾和信號衰減,提高單片機(jī)的穩(wěn)定性。

2.軟件編程與優(yōu)化

軟件編程是單片機(jī)應(yīng)用的核心,因此我們需要注重軟件的編寫質(zhì)量。選擇合適的編程語言,編寫簡潔、高效的代碼,并不斷優(yōu)化算法,提高程序的執(zhí)行效率。此外,通過模塊化設(shè)計(jì),提高代碼的可讀性和可維護(hù)性。

3.環(huán)境適應(yīng)性改進(jìn)

針對環(huán)境因素對單片機(jī)穩(wěn)定性的影響,可以通過以下措施來提高單片機(jī)的環(huán)境適應(yīng)性:

-選擇對環(huán)境因素干擾抵抗力強(qiáng)的元器件;

-在電路設(shè)計(jì)中加入濾波、屏蔽等抗干擾措施;

-對單片機(jī)進(jìn)行環(huán)境適應(yīng)性測試,確保其在各種環(huán)境下都能穩(wěn)定運(yùn)行。

4.技術(shù)跟蹤與人才培養(yǎng)

為了跟上技術(shù)更新的步伐,我們需要不斷學(xué)習(xí)新技術(shù),關(guān)注行業(yè)動(dòng)態(tài)。同時(shí),加強(qiáng)單片機(jī)領(lǐng)域的人才培養(yǎng),通過教育和培訓(xùn),提高工程師的專業(yè)技能和創(chuàng)新能力。

5.成本控制與效益平衡

在成本控制方面,可以通過以下途徑來降低成本:

-選擇性價(jià)比高的元器件和組件;

-采用標(biāo)準(zhǔn)化、模塊化的設(shè)計(jì),提高生產(chǎn)效率;

-通過批量采購降低采購成本。

6.增強(qiáng)系統(tǒng)安全性

在單片機(jī)應(yīng)用中,安全性是一個(gè)不可忽視的問題。為了提高系統(tǒng)的安全性,我們可以采取以下措施:

-加強(qiáng)軟件安全,防止惡意代碼的入侵;

-在硬件設(shè)計(jì)上,增加安全保護(hù)措施,如過壓保護(hù)、過流保護(hù)等;

-定期對系統(tǒng)進(jìn)行安全檢查和更新,確保系統(tǒng)的安全性。

五:結(jié)論

1.單片機(jī)作為現(xiàn)代電子技術(shù)的重要組成部分,其穩(wěn)定性和可靠性是確保其應(yīng)用效果的關(guān)鍵。在實(shí)際應(yīng)用中,我們需要關(guān)注硬件設(shè)計(jì)、軟件編程和環(huán)境適應(yīng)性等方面,以提高單片機(jī)的性能和穩(wěn)定性。

2.軟件編程是單片機(jī)應(yīng)用的核心,優(yōu)化編程技術(shù)、提高代碼執(zhí)行效率,以及模塊化設(shè)計(jì),對于提升單片機(jī)應(yīng)用水平具有重要意義。

3.環(huán)境因素對單片機(jī)的穩(wěn)定運(yùn)行有著重要影響。通過選擇合適的元器件、優(yōu)化電路設(shè)計(jì)和加強(qiáng)抗干擾措施,可以提高單片機(jī)在各種環(huán)境下的適應(yīng)性。

4.隨著技術(shù)的不斷發(fā)展,我們需要關(guān)注技術(shù)更新動(dòng)態(tài),加強(qiáng)人才培養(yǎng),以適應(yīng)市場需求的變化。

5.成本控制是單片機(jī)應(yīng)用中的一個(gè)重要問題。通過選擇性價(jià)比高的元器件、優(yōu)化設(shè)計(jì)和批量采購,可以在保證性能和品質(zhì)的前提下降低成本。

6.安全性是單片機(jī)應(yīng)用中不可忽視的問題。加強(qiáng)軟件和硬件的安全設(shè)計(jì),以及定期進(jìn)行安全檢查和更新,對于保障系統(tǒng)安全至關(guān)重要。

參考文獻(xiàn):

[1]張三,李四.單片機(jī)原理與

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論